
The festive period is giving the Island a brief respite from the rigours of the present economic squeeze, but there is the warning that "more pain is on the way".
A major departmental reshuffle is planned for the early part of 2014.
Chief Minister Allan Bell says the only way to achieve the rebalancing of the Manx budget, forced on the Island by the cuts in income, is a painful one:
